## Health Checks

All services behind the Quillgate load balancer expose `/healthz` on port 8443. If a node is marked unhealthy for more than five minutes, query the Quillgate status API directly before draining it, since transient DNS hiccups are common in the Torvane cluster. The status API is internal-only and requires authentication, so use the key below when calling it.

gateway credential: kto23_LX9A4ys6i4nzHtpOLNLodKK

## Onboarding: The Flickerline Reconnect Bug

Welcome aboard! Before you cut your first Flickerline release, know about our infamous websocket reconnect bug. When the gateway restarts mid-deploy, clients sometimes hammer reconnects every 50ms instead of backing off. The fix shipped in 4.2, but older clients still misbehave, so we always deploy gateways one node at a time. The rollout script handles pacing, but it needs to authenticate against the release host first, and you deploy under your own credentials. Your deploy key goes right below.

rollout seal: bky4_x7Gc

Subject: Key rotation for InvoiceForge renderer

Welcome, new folks. Every quarter we rotate the credential the Pellworth PDF invoice renderer uses to call our internal asset service, Vaultline. The old key stops working Friday at noon. Update your local .env and the staging config before then, and verify a test invoice renders with the new embedded fonts. For convenience, the freshly issued key is included here.

app token of bagef-bageg = kto11_vuwA0uhrEMg

Team — Threshbow now hot-reloads config. Push changes to the config repo; the watcher applies them within ten seconds, no restart. Caveats: connection-pool sizes and listener ports still need a full restart, and bad YAML is rejected, not applied, so check the reload log. New folks: never edit config on the box directly. Rolling to all regions tonight. Verify your pods are on the build identified by the token below.

build token for tawip-yageg: htk9_92ac43d42